    The Role of Local Anesthesia

    The key to ensuring a comfortable and pain-free experience during a hair transplant in Westmount is the use of local anesthesia. This method involves administering a numbing agent directly to the scalp, effectively blocking any sensation of pain. Patients often report feeling only mild pressure or tugging during the procedure, but no significant discomfort. The anesthetic is carefully applied to ensure that the entire area where the transplant will take place is completely numb, allowing the surgeon to work efficiently and precisely.

    Procedure Details

    The hair transplant process involves two main techniques: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) and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T). In FUE, individual hair follicles are extracted from the donor area and implanted into the recipient area. FUT involves removing a strip of skin from the donor area, which is then dissected into individual follicular units for implantation. Both methods are performed under local anesthesia, ensuring the patient's comfort.
